Companies have always been trying to find the best ways to secure a loyal customer base. A company that seems to have found the best way to achieve this is the Dollar Shave Club. They know how to best use humor and customer appeal to create a company that speaks well to their target demographic. America loves the idea of time and money savers but, that’s not enough to completely sell us to a product. Clever marketing and funny ads are critical to the success of any product.
Take for example amazon prime. This is a service that, for a yearly fee of $100, gives customers free 2 day shipping. With as many as 50 million subscribers currently using the service for its speedy and cheap delivery of items, it exemplifies an ideal that our culture holds sacred, efficiency (GeekWire). Another prime example of efficiency is NFL Sunday ticket. With this service you can seamlessly watch every NFL game live on just one screen. Why watch just one game when you can watch them all? The title is great for pulling in viewers because of its explicitness, another thing us as Americans seem to value. The actual commercial plays mostly to the viewers’ sense of pathos. Laughter, which this ad is sure to induce, is a sure fire way that a consumer will remain interested throughout the ad. Throughout the course of the commercial the viewers are taken through the Dollar Shave Club warehouse as Michael puts down other razor companies and sarcastically tells the viewer how their life will be dramatically better if they start using his product. If the commercial isn’t enough to sell the customers the product, the Dollar Shave Club offers a service that screams efficiency.
